508 West 29th Street, Manhattan, NY 10001
508 West 29th Street is a 5-story, 29-unit Old Law Tenement building in Chelsea, constructed in 1901 and currently owned by John Ilibassi. The building has experienced recurring heating system issues in January 2024, with four emergency heat/hot water complaints filed in three consecutive weeks, though HPD was unable to gain access for inspections. Prior to this, the building faced a significant mold issue in December 2022, which was verified and corrected according to HPD records.
Between 2018-2021, there were multiple notable safety concerns, particularly regarding fire escapes, with several complaints filed in 2018 about egress issues, though no violations were ultimately issued. More recently, from 2021-2022, the building has been subject to several Environmental Control Board violations related to fire safety systems and occupancy issues, particularly concerning an unauthorized transient use of Apartment 10. These violations include failure to provide required sprinkler and fire alarm systems, and problems with means of egress, generating substantial penalties totaling $40,000. The building's maintenance history shows consistent compliance with bedbug reporting requirements since 2019, with no reported infestations, and recent rodent inspections (as of 2024) have been passed, indicating improved pest management compared to earlier years with multiple rat activity findings between 2017-2018.
The building has undergone various repairs and maintenance work, with several permits issued in 2024 for emergency work. A particular area of concern has been the building's compliance with immediately hazardous violations, with certain violations issued in 2018-2021 remaining active as of the latest records, though these were dismissed in one instance in 2021. The property's inspection and complaint history shows periodic issues with access during inspections, as evidenced by multiple cases where inspectors were unable to gain entry, affecting the resolution of complaints. While many historical violations have been resolved and the building has maintained proper bedbug reporting compliance, the recurring heating issues in 2024 and active violations related to fire safety systems and occupancy use represent the most pressing current concerns, though these are somewhat mitigated by recent inspections passing certain safety requirements.
